If you’ve been thinking of OnlyFans as an easy backup in case your career goals go belly up, we’ve got bad news for you: running a financially profitable OnlyFans channel takes actual work. There’s a common misconception that OnlyFans models “just film themselves” and earn millions overnight, but quite a bit of effort goes on behind the scenes for successful content creators.

Need proof that OnlyFans isn’t easy money? Meet Hayley Davies, a top creator on OnlyFans. Hayley works a minimum of 100 hours per week to maintain her channel and keep it turning a profit. Her daily tasks include creating content, editing footage, messaging subscribers, promoting her channel across platforms, managing collaborations, troubleshooting technical issues, and checking her security—because stolen content doesn’t pay, and sex workers face alarming rates of stalking. All these daily tasks require a significant time investment, not to mention the entrepreneurial skills necessary to keep the wheels turning. If that sounds like she’s running a small business, it’s because she is.

More than just a hub for explicit content, OnlyFans is home to creators who thrive by offering exclusive fitness programs, cooking tutorials, and a wide variety of niche content protected by a paywall. Numerous Olympians have joined OnlyFans, sharing exclusive looks at their workout and meal prep routines. Artists provide small-session courses, and culinary experts share their expertise with paid subscribers, allowing them to pursue their passions without being at the mercy of a commercial kitchen. These creators thrive alongside those who share explicit content, proving that making money on OnlyFans requires a commitment to creating content that justifies the time invested.

While creators invest so much time and energy into their work, it’s not just a time investment—it’s a heart investment. The secret sauce to OnlyFans success is forming and maintaining emotional connections with subscribers, which takes significant emotional energy to do authentically. Maintaining positive parasocial relationships with a viewership is tricky. Add in the mental load of staying relevant, managing negativity, and handling societal judgment that comes with being successful on OnlyFans, and… well, it’s heavy. On top of that, the internet is always open, and fans frequently expect 24/7 engagement. This leaves creators with very little personal time, despite running channels that were supposed to give them control over their schedules.

OnlyFans success isn’t about luck. It takes hard work to build successful channels with engaged audiences. While many people still believe content creation isn’t a “real job,” OnlyFans creators earning a living frequently put in more than double the hours of a traditional 9-to-5 job.
